What is Selective Perception?

Selective perception refers to the subconscious filtration process that occurs in our brains, allowing us to process and interpret information based on our pre-existing beliefs and biases. It is the tendency to selectively attend to certain aspects of our environment, while filtering out or distorting others that do not align with our preconceived notions.

Causes of Selective Perception

Selective perception arises from a combination of factors, ranging from our upbringing and personal experiences to cultural influences and societal norms. Our brains constantly receive an overwhelming amount of information from our surroundings; as a result, we unconsciously prioritise what is most familiar and relevant to us. Over time, this repetitive filtering becomes automatic, allowing us to quickly process information while ignoring or downplaying contradictory details.

The Impact of Selective Perception

Selective perception has profound consequences on how we perceive and interact with the world. It shapes our reality by reinforcing our existing beliefs and biases, often leading us to form judgements and opinions without considering alternative perspectives. This confirmation bias can be detrimental, hindering our ability to understand complex issues objectively and fostering divisive thinking.

Furthermore, selective perception influences our interpersonal relationships. It can contribute to misunderstandings, conflicts, and biases, as we tend to interpret others’ actions and words in ways that validate our preconceived notions about them. By recognising that selective perception exists, we can take steps to mitigate its negative effects and promote empathy, understanding, and open-mindedness.

Overcoming Selective Perception

While selective perception is deeply ingrained in human nature, we can actively work towards overcoming its limitations. By acknowledging our biases and engaging in self-reflection, we can become more aware of the filters through which we perceive and interpret information. Engaging in dialogue with individuals whose perspectives differ from our own can provide valuable insights and challenge our existing beliefs.

Additionally, seeking out diverse sources of information, exposing ourselves to different cultures, and actively fostering empathy can help broaden our horizons and reduce the influence of selective perception. By recognising that everyone experiences selective perception, we can cultivate an atmosphere of open-mindedness and respect for diverse opinions, leading to greater understanding and cooperation.
